Pachyserica huanglianensis is a species of beetle of the family Scarabaeidae. It is found in China (Yunnan).
Adults reach a length of about 9.4âÂÂ10 mm. They have a dark brown, elongate-oval body, partly with a greenish iridescent sheen. The antennae are yellowish-brown. The surface is entirely dull (except for the shiny labroclypeus). The upper surface has numerous fine, diffusely arranged, white scale-like hairs and a few erect, short, thin scale-like hairs.
The species is named after its type locality, Huanglian Shan.
